Road installation services involve the construction, repair, and resurfacing of driveways, private roads, and access pathways on residential and commercial properties. These services typically include preparing the ground, laying down durable materials such as asphalt, concrete, or gravel, and ensuring proper drainage and stability. Skilled contractors focus on creating smooth, long-lasting surfaces that improve the functionality and appearance of a property’s exterior. Proper installation can help prevent common issues like cracking, potholes, and uneven surfaces, making daily use safer and more convenient.
Many property owners turn to road installation services when their existing driveways or access roads have become damaged or unsafe. Cracks, potholes, or crumbling surfaces can pose hazards and reduce curb appeal. Additionally, properties that are being developed or renovated may require new access roads to accommodate increased traffic or to meet specific zoning requirements. These services also help resolve drainage problems caused by poorly constructed surfaces, which can lead to water pooling or erosion. The overview below groups typical Road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Nashua, NH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or road installation repairs in Nashua range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this band, depending on the scope of work and materials used.
Medium-Size Projects - Medium-scale installations, such as driveway repaving or minor lane additions, us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for local contractors handling residential or small commercial sites.
Large Installations - Larger, more complex road installation projects like extensive paving or new surface construction can reach $5,000 to $15,000 or more. Many of these projects are for commercial properties or multi-site developments.
Full Replacement and Major Projects - Complete road replacements or extensive infrastructure upgrades often cost $20,000+ in Nashua and surrounding areas. Such projects are less frequent but involve significant planning and resources from experienced local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
